郁啲撞火
  keoi5 juk1 di1 zong6 fo2, zong6 can1 fo2 zau6 min6 dou1 hung4 saai3.   jyutping
His face flares red whenever he gets cross, which happens quite often.

Cantonese language often prefers 'simple' repetition (撞火) to 'unnatural' conjunction (such as 每當) for the sense of "whenever".
This sentence is in Cantonese, not Mandarin/Standard written Chinese.
